This situation occurs because the software is not compatible with Windows 10. You just have to visit a Support page for your product to download the updated version of Netgear USB Control Center and remove the old version installed on your PC. However, if that's just the only problem and the software works normally, go to Start > Run > msconfig and switch to the Startup tab. Uncheck Netgear entry from the list, and the software won't start automatically anymore, but you need to launch it manually from now on when you want to use it on the PC where it's installed.
